Conflicting Rules?

Quote:
4.3.6 FIRST recognizes that it is the responsibility of each team to design and construct their ROBOT within.....On the software side, writing actual lines of code, verification of syntax, final debugging, etc would all be considered development of the final software implementation, and must be completed during the approved fabrication periods.
Quote:
<R24> During the period between ship date and the competitions, all teams may manufacture SPARE, REPLACEMENT, and UPGRADE PARTS, and develop software for their ROBOT at their home facility... This will allow teams to have the maximum time possible prior to each competition event to develop and complete the software for their ROBOT while maximizing the potential capabilities provided by the control system
These two rules seem to conflict them selfs one says you can't develop software after the build season (4.3.6). And one says you can (<R24>)
